Binary search tree c++ stl
Web2012-09-09 19:15:31 2 12038 java / algorithm / tree / binary-search-tree Finding the parent of a node in a Binary tree 2014-05-25 14:59:29 5 31967 java / data-structures / binary-tree / parent WebFeb 13, 2024 · Notes:. Here we use a public Insert(int val) method for inserting a new node into the tree and a private Insert(int val, TreeNode* node) helper method for inserting a new node into the subtree starting at …
Binary search tree c++ stl
Did you know?
WebBinary Search is a searching algorithm for finding an element's position in a sorted array. In this tutorial, you will understand the working of binary search with working code in C, C++, Java, and Python. WebMar 13, 2011 · Since the STL can't anticipate which is the best choice for your application, the default needs to be more flexible. Trees "just work" and scale nicely. (C++11 did add …
WebFeb 13, 2024 · What is Binary Search Tree? A binary Search Tree is a node-based binary tree data structure which has the following properties: The left subtree of a node contains only nodes with keys lesser than the … Webc++ dictionary data-structures stl binary-search-tree 本文是小编为大家收集整理的关于 为什么std::map被实现为红黑树? 的处理/解决方法,可以参考本文帮助大家快速定位并解决问题,中文翻译不准确的可切换到 English 标签页查看源文。
WebC++ bsearch () The bsearch () function in C++ performs a binary search of an element in an array of elements and returns a pointer to the element if found. The bsearch () function requires all elements less than the element to be searched to the left of it in the array. Likewise, all elements greater than the element to be searched must be to ... WebC++ std::lower_bound不是专为红黑树迭代器设计的,有什么技术原因吗? ,c++,algorithm,c++11,stl,binary-search-tree,C++,Algorithm,C++11,Stl,Binary Search Tree,如果我向它传递一对红黑树迭代器(set::iterator或map::iterator),我总是假设std::lower_bound()以对数时间运行。
WebThe Standard Template Library (STL) is a software library originally designed by Alexander Stepanov for the C++ programming language that influenced many parts of the C++ Standard Library.It provides four components called algorithms, containers, functions, and iterators.. The STL provides a set of common classes for C++, such as containers …
http://duoduokou.com/cplusplus/26922690293536707081.html philips tam8905/10 home audio systeemWebSee complete series on data structures here:http://www.youtube.com/playlist?list=PL2_aWCzGMAwI3W_JlcBbtYTwiQSsOTa6PIn this lesson, we have implemented binary... philip stand mixerWebMar 24, 2024 · Detailed Tutorial on Binary Search Tree (BST) In C++ Including Operations, C++ Implementation, Advantages, and Example Programs: A Binary Search Tree or BST as it is popularly called is a … philip standerWebSelf-balancing binary search trees are an important type of data structures used in the underlying implementation of many containers, libraries, and algorithms. ... In our extra plan, we intended to integrate our lock-free red-black tree into C++ standard template library(STL) to facilitate the measurement of performance. However, we discovered ... philips tam6805/10 testWebC++ STL and binary search trees Of these, set is one that is implemented using a balanced binary search tree (typically a red-black tree) Let’s look at some aspects of … try again westlifeWebJan 29, 2024 · In case of a given Binary Tree, convert it to a Binary Search Tree in such a way that keeps the original structure of Binary Tree intact. Sets of C++ STL will be used … try again when login to firefoxWebJan 3, 2024 · Binary Search Tree - Search and Insertion Operations in C++. C++ Server Side Programming Programming. Binary search tree (BST) is a special type of tree which follows the following rules −. left child node’s value is always less than the parent Note. right child node has a greater value than the parent node. philip stanfield